It has filed its return of income electronically on 29.8.2008 and 29.9.2009 declaring total income at Rs. 14,56,66,218/- and Rs. 17,63,31,404/- in the Asstt.year 2008-09 and 2009-10 respectively. In the Asstt.Year 2008-09, the assessee has revised its return on 16.9.2009 whereby it has disclosed income at Rs. 14,38,76,632/-. The case of the assessee for both the years were selected for scrutiny assessment and notice under section 143(2) was issued and served upon the assessee. On scrutiny of accounts it revealed to the AO that the assessee has made a provision of Rs. 23,09,500/- in Asstt.Year 2008-09 and Rs. 23,93,080/- in Asstt.Year 2009-10. According to the assessee it has provided a scheme vide which if its sub-commission agent achieve a particular target then sub-agent will be entitled for a foreign tour provided by the assessee. For the purpose of providing such tour, the assessee has made provision, because these sub-agents have achieved their target. ....bove, it is evident that the Assessing Officer has not doubted that tour was to be arranged by assessee as a part of Sales Promotion expenses. He disallowed the expenses mainly on the ground that there was no basis for the provision and the tour was actually conducted in the next year and all the expenditures were actually incurred in next year. In our opinion, when the assessee has promised to arrange the tour for its clients, sub commission agents and Engineers on the basis of their performance during the year under consideration, then persons who achieved the target given by the assessee have acquired the right to go on tour as per the Scheme of assessee. Therefore, once the assessee's clients, commission agents and Engineers fulfill the target given to them, the assessee incurs the liability to take them on tour to Egypt as per the Scheme. Therefore, the provision for Egypt tour is to be allowed in the year under consideration. Now the only question is whether the provision made by the assessee is reasonable or not. In the Asstt.year 2009-10, the next issue agitated by the assessee is that the ld.CIT(A) has allowed a sum of Rs. 23,09,500/- on payment basis. 12. The facts regarding this issue are that in the asstt.Year 2008-09, the assessee has made a provision of Rs. 23,09,500/- pertaining to the China Tour. This provision was disallowed by the AO in the Asstt.Year 2008-09. It has claimed this amount on actual payment basis in the Asstt.Year 2009-10. The ld.CIT(A) theoretically allowed, but with a rider that in case provision is allowed to the assessee in Asstt.Year 2008-09, then the deduction granted in Asstt.Year 2009-10 on actual incurrence of the expenditure would be withdrawn.
